Chattanooga: EPB’s bad debt at lowest level

EPB in December wrote off about $344,000 in bad debt, the least ever, despite the economy.

The write-off in December was 0.128 percent of electricity sales, versus 0.157 percent of sales a year ago, said Danna Bailey Cannon, vice president of marketing.

The write-off is the lowest that EPB has recorded, she said. Most electric utilities write off about 0.3 percent in bad debts.

Mrs. Cannon said she attributes the low write-off to EPB’s flexible bill payment options as well as customers’ emphasizing paying essential bills.
